Job description
- Synthesis, Physical design and implementation of CPU and GPU cores, system interconnect and other ARM IP, SoC
- Analyze design timing, area and power to help improve the quality of ARM IP
- Develop and deploy new methodologies to improve implementation efficiency and results
- Support and develop detailed implementation analysis and data-mining methodologies.
- Work with implementation and physical IP RTL design teams to drive analysis and optimization of our IP.
- Converting R&D concepts into real implementation solutions.
- Enable our partners to achieve the best possible quality of results.
Requirements
- Bachelors or Master’s degree equivalent in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ering or other relevant technical fields.
- 7+ years of proven experience in ASIC Implementation, Physical design, STA and Timing closure, Structured clock tree, PDN analysis, DFM and Physical verification
- The ability to demonstrate that you can express new insights and communicate them effectively. Possess a high level of dedicated, initiative and problem-solving skills.
- Experience in crafting and adopting new silicon implementation techniques and methodologies and promote their use with international teams
- Previous experience in and knowledge of the entire IC design flow, from RTL through to GDS2. Proven programming and scripting skills eg. Tcl, Perl, R, Make, sh.
“Nice To Have” Skills and Experience :
- Knowledge around Arm based CPUs and SoCs!
- Experience with low power design techniques (power gating, voltage/frequency scaling)
- Experience with Verilog RTL design.
- Experience with ATPG tools/and or production testing.
About the company
As an Implementation Engineer in Arm’s Solutions Engineering group we like to think we are not just crafting sophisticated CPUs, GPUs and SoCs, but we are defining future chip design techniques. Not only do we improve the power, performance and system integration of our products, but we also craft the design flows, influence Electronic Design Automation (EDA) tools and build the knowledge base that makes custom SoC, CPU and GPU chip design possible.
At Arm, our work goes beyond multiple divisions where we drive improved implementation for Arm and our partners. A key component of this is around the development of comprehensive implementation and analysis methodologies.
